Group 1: Company Overview - Northrop Grumman Corporation (NOC) is an aerospace and defense technology company based in Falls Church, Virginia, with a market cap of $102.8 billion, providing products such as stealth aircraft, autonomous systems, missile defense solutions, radar and cybersecurity technologies, and space satellites and launch systems [1] - NOC is classified as a "large-cap stock" due to its market cap exceeding $10 billion, highlighting its size, influence, and dominance in the aerospace and defense industry [2] Group 2: Financial Performance - NOC's shares have surged 27.7% over the past three months, outperforming the State Street Industrial Select Sector SPDR ETF's (XLI) 15.9% increase during the same period [3] - Year-to-date, NOC shares are up 27%, compared to XLI's 14.2% rise, and over the past 52 weeks, NOC has increased by 57.5%, outpacing XLI's 31.7% gain [5] - On January 27, NOC reported better-than-expected fourth-quarter results, with net sales climbing 9.6% year over year to $11.7 billion, slightly exceeding consensus estimates, and adjusted EPS of $7.23, up 13.1% year over year and 3.3% above analyst forecasts [7] Group 3: Market Position - NOC has been trading 2.8% below its 52-week high of $745.55, reached on February 19, and has maintained a bullish trend by trading above its 200-day moving average since mid-June [3][5] - NOC has outperformed its rival, Lockheed Martin Corporation (LMT), which surged 47.4% over the past 52 weeks, although NOC has lagged behind LMT's 36.1% rise on a year-to-date basis [8]

Core Insights - KBR is launching a strategic initiative to enhance its digital engineering capabilities for the U.S. military, focusing on rapid modernization in response to emerging threats and technological advancements [1] Group 1: Digital Engineering Expansion - KBR is investing in advanced digital labs across the U.S. to improve the development and sustainment of defense systems, transitioning from traditional methods to digital environments for faster data-driven insights [2] - The digital twin and model-based system engineering environment at KBR enables rapid prototyping and large-scale system modeling, simulation, and software development, enhancing operational efficiency throughout the project lifecycle [2] Group 2: Modernization and Efficiency - The Department of War (DoW) is prioritizing speed in modernizing warfighting capabilities, and KBR's expertise in virtual mission simulation allows for cost and time savings by digitizing scenarios in a lab setting [3] - KBR's team in Huntsville, Alabama, has advanced virtual prototyping for major defense systems, enabling quicker evaluation and refinement of designs, which supports informed decision-making throughout the system lifecycle [3] Group 3: Historical Context and Achievements - Over the past decade, KBR has been instrumental in transforming critical capabilities, providing integrated air and missile defense systems, and developing modeling and simulation tools for new technologies [4] - KBR has established digital prototyping labs for various government customers, aimed at modernizing both new and legacy systems [4] Group 4: Company Overview - KBR employs approximately 36,000 people globally, serving customers in over 85 countries and operating in more than 28 countries, delivering technology and long-term services [5]

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- Revenues for Q4 2025 totaled $980.1 million, at the top end of guidance, with IT consulting revenues comprising 63%, up from 59% year-over-year [5][23] - Adjusted EBITDA margin was 11%, exceeding expectations, with free cash flow of $93.7 million, representing a conversion rate of approximately 87% of adjusted EBITDA [5][26] - Net income for Q4 was $25.2 million, with a gross margin of 28.9%, consistent with the prior year [24][25]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Commercial segment revenues were $698.6 million, a 0.9% increase year-over-year, while federal segment revenues were $281.5 million, a decrease of 3.7% year-over-year [23][24] - Commercial consulting revenues, the largest high-margin stream, increased by 19.2% year-over-year to $339.4 million [23] - Assignment revenue declined by 12% year-over-year, reflecting softness in parts of the commercial segment sensitive to macroeconomic changes [23]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- In the commercial segment, healthcare accounts improved by mid-teens, while consumer and industrial accounts improved by low teens [13] - Federal segment revenues from defense and intelligence improved low single digits year-over-year, driven by funding for Project Maven [15] - The other clients category in the federal segment saw mid-teens growth year-over-year due to expansion in data, AI, and modernization efforts [15]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is transitioning to a new brand, Everforth, to unify its commercial and federal identities and enhance cross-selling opportunities [7] - Strategic acquisitions, such as the recent intent to acquire Quinnox for $290 million, are part of the strategy to enhance digital engineering and global delivery capabilities [8][28] - The focus remains on organic revenue growth while pursuing acquisitions that enhance solution capabilities and technology partnerships [7][8]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ed optimism about strong demand for AI solutions, with nearly 80% of enterprises planning to increase AI spending in 2026 [4] - The company anticipates strong award activity in the federal segment, particularly in defense and intelligence, as budget support increases [46] - Management highlighted the importance of addressing challenges in scaling AI and integrating it into core business strategies [19][20] Other Important Information - The company generated $288.1 million in free cash flow for the full year 2025, with $170.1 million used for share repurchases [27][28] - The effective tax rate for Q4 was 36.4%, above the forecasted 28%, due to one-time items [25] - The company has approximately $972 million remaining on its $1 billion share repurchase authorization [28] Q&A Session Summary Question: Focus on M&A strategy and comfort with leverage - Management emphasized organic growth as the primary focus, with acquisitions aimed at enhancing solution capabilities based on client needs [36] - Post-acquisition leverage is expected to be at 2.9, which is considered modestly leveraged [38] Question: Capital allocation between stock buybacks and acquisitions - Management noted that both share repurchases and acquisitions are accretive, and a balanced strategy is essential [42][44] Question: Outlook for government consulting business - Management expects strong award activity in the federal segment, particularly in defense and intelligence, despite delays from the government shutdown [46] Question: Client demand for AI and impact on staffing - Management indicated that AI is driving demand, but clients are being judicious with staffing, focusing on outcome-based investments [51] Question: Commercial consulting growth mix and revenue visibility - Growth in commercial consulting is driven by project-based work, with a healthy mix of long-term projects expected to improve revenue visibility [59][61]
